Personalized neoadjuvant strategy using 70-gene assay to increase breast-conserving surgery in ER+/HER2– breast cancer
Abstract We investigated whether tailored neoadjuvant therapy (chemotherapy [NCT] or endocrine therapy [NET]) guided by a 70-gene assay could improve breast-conserving surgery (BCS) rates among patients with ER-positive/HER2-negative breast cancer initially deemed ineligible for BCS.
